Duo arrested after packages taken from multiple homes, deputies say

OCSO: Both were in possession of packages, property from 12 different homes

ORANGE COUNTY, Fla. – Two people have been arrested after they allegedly took packages from multiple homes.

The Orange County Sheriff's Office said 911 was called after 4 p.m. Friday about suspicious activities of two people in the caller's neighborhood.

The caller told authorities the two were removing packages from the front doorsteps of multiple homes in the area, deputies said. The caller provided a detailed description of the duo and their vehicle, which helped responding deputies find and detain them.

Deputies said it was determined the two -- who were identified by the Sheriff's Office as Alexander Reyes, 18, and a 15-year-old boy -- were in possession of packages and property from 12 different homes in the area.

Reyes and the teenage boy were arrested and charged for multiple felony crimes, deputies said.

The Sheriff's Office said a follow-up investigation is ongoing as deputies attempt to make contact with each of the victims.
